Transaction 4526ef06881b566d88b0858b80d3d40877bf0897fe3480ab44a7786443c8ef8a
1 Input
1 Output
-
4526ef06881b566d88b0858b80d3d40877bf0897fe3480ab44a7786443c8ef8a:0
- value
- 332590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 671a64e6de3b6ee94e9ee618e59715c713f0aae3 OP_EQUAL
- address
- 3B6B9CYTn3NuAR5q6tVAXBbPeEu1J8ZKHZ